  • When did polyacrylamide (PHPA) become available?
  • Partially hydrolysed polyacrylamide (PHPA) became accessible in the foundation industry in the early 1990s ( Lam and Jefferis, 2014 ). Besides, PHPA can be applied in oilfield nowadays, especially in Daqing oilfield, where it is most superior with polymer flooding technique in China ( Zhong et al., 2025 ).

  • What is the pH range of modified polyacrylamide drilling fluid?
  • Besides, Shettigar et al. (2018) also developed a modified grafted polyacrylamide by maintaining the pH value of 9 by using sodium hydroxide. In short, the modified polyacrylamide drilling fluid must be maintained at a pH range of 7–10 to avoid an acidic environment that is harmful to the environment and society.
